Trucker hats have been a popular fashion accessory for decades. These hats are characterized by their mesh back and foam front, which is often adorned with a logo or graphic. They were originally worn by truck drivers and farmers to keep the sun out of their eyes, but have since become a staple in the fashion world. History of Trucker Hats

Trucker hats have a long and interesting history. They were first introduced in the 1960s as a promotional item for trucking companies. These hats were given away to truck drivers as a way to promote the company and create brand awareness. The hats were practical, with a mesh back that allowed air to circulate and keep the driver cool, and a foam front that provided shade from the sun.

In the 1970s, trucker hats became more popular among farmers and ranchers. These hats were practical for working outdoors, and the foam front provided a surface for attaching patches and logos. The hats were also inexpensive and easy to find, making them a popular choice for those who needed a durable and functional hat.

In the 1980s, trucker hats began to make their way into popular culture. They were worn by celebrities and musicians, and were often seen in movies and TV shows. This helped to increase their popularity and make them more mainstream.

Rise in Popularity

The popularity of trucker hats really took off in the early 2000s. This was due in large part to the influence of the skateboarding and surf culture. These subcultures embraced the trucker hat as a fashion accessory, and it quickly became a must-have item for anyone who wanted to look cool and trendy.

Celebrities also played a role in the rise of trucker hats. Ashton Kutcher was often seen wearing a trucker hat on his hit TV show, "Punk'd," and this helped to make the hat even more popular. Other celebrities, such as Justin Timberlake and Pharrell Williams, were also known for wearing trucker hats.

The popularity of trucker hats eventually peaked in the mid-2000s. However, they have remained a popular fashion accessory ever since. Today, you can find trucker hats in a wide variety of styles and designs, from classic mesh and foam hats to more modern versions with flat brims and snapback closures.

Enduring Appeal

So why do trucker hats continue to be popular? There are several reasons. For one, they are practical and functional. The mesh back allows air to circulate, keeping the wearer cool, while the foam front provides shade from the sun. They are also durable and easy to clean, making them a great choice for outdoor activities.

Trucker hats also have a nostalgic appeal. They are associated with a simpler time, when life was less complicated and people were more connected to the outdoors. This nostalgia is especially appealing to younger generations who may not have experienced this type of lifestyle firsthand.

Finally, trucker hats have become a fashion statement. They are often worn as a way to express one's personality or interests. Many trucker hats feature logos or graphics that reflect a particular brand or subculture. They can also be customized with patches or embroidery, making them a unique and personalized accessory.
